Ruth Wratten Obituary

Ruth A. Wratten of Fort Walton Beach, Florida, passed away Monday June 1, 2020 at the age of 71. She was born in June 6, 1948, in Elizabeth, New Jersey, the daughter of the late William H. and Ruth B. Wratten.

Ruth was a long-time active member of the Covenant Community Church. Defined by her faith, her love of family and friends, and her devotion to her students, Ruth’s life exemplified one of her favorite verses from Scripture, Romans 8:28: “And we know that all good things work together for good to those that love God, to those who are called according to his purpose.”

For Ruth, that purpose was being a teacher. Her career spanned 50 years in Fort Walton Beach elementary schools, where she eventually specialized as a reading teacher for young learners. Her dedication to her students was reflected in their great affection for her.

Ruth was always there for her family and friends. She was a sympathetic listener and a wise counselor, maintaining lifelong friendships. She was also devoted to her golden retriever, Dreamer, who was her companion for many years.

Ruth is survived by her siblings, Betty Wratten of Fort Walton Beach, FL and her brother, William B. Wratten of Chicago, IL; the David Salzman family and the Bobby Salzman family; as well as a host of cousins and many wonderful friends.

A gentle, yet strong, and generous soul, Ruth will be missed as much as she was loved.

Services will be private. A celebration of Ruth’s life will be planned for a later date. In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to Covenant Community Church for its ongoing children’s mission in Uganda (cccfwb.com, scroll to the bottom to donate and type Uganda in the message box).
